document.addEventListener('DOMContentLoaded', () => {
const mapDiv = document.getElementById("map");
const mapContainer = document.getElementById("mapContainer");
const radarButton = document.getElementById("mapLabel");
const hideLocationButton = document.getElementById("hideLocation");
const mapReturn = document.getElementById("mapReturn");
const alertEventBG = document.getElementById('alertContainer');
const alertEvent = document.getElementById('eventText');
const alertDetails = document.getElementById('detailsForPolygon');
const alertDropdown = document.getElementById('alertDropdown');
const dropdownIcon = document.getElementById('dropdownIcon');
const descriptionDisplay = document.getElementById('description');
const closeWarningButton = document.getElementById('closeAlert');
const locationButton = document.getElementById('hideLocation');
var showLocation = true;
const playButton = document.getElementById('playRadar');
const radarApi = 'https://api.rainviewer.com/public/weather-maps.json';
function loadMap() {
navigator.geolocation.getCurrentPosition(setMapToLocation, function() {return;}, { enableHighAccuracy: true });
}
function setMapToLocation(location) {
const coords = [location.coords.latitude, location.coords.longitude];
// const coords = [44, -103] // use for testing
var map = L.map('map', {zoomControl: false}).setView(coords, 10);
L.tileLayer('https://tile.openstreetmap.org/{z}/{x}/{y}.png', {
maxZoom: 19,
attribution: '© <a href="http://www.openstreetmap.org/copyright">OpenStreetMap</a>'
}).addTo(map);
// var animatingRadar = false;
// let radarInterval;
// function animateRadar(val) {
// if (val) {
// function animateSteps() {
// fetchAndDisplayRadarData(0);
// setTimeout(() => {fetchAndDisplayRadarData(1);}, 1000);
// setTimeout(() => {fetchAndDisplayRadarData(2);}, 2000);
// setTimeout(() => {fetchAndDisplayRadarData(3);}, 3000);
// setTimeout(() => {fetchAndDisplayRadarData(4);}, 4000);
// setTimeout(() => {fetchAndDisplayRadarData(5);}, 5000);
// setTimeout(() => {fetchAndDisplayRadarData(6);}, 6000);
// setTimeout(() => {fetchAndDisplayRadarData(7);}, 7000);
// setTimeout(() => {fetchAndDisplayRadarData(8);}, 8000);
// setTimeout(() => {fetchAndDisplayRadarData(9);}, 9000);
// setTimeout(() => {fetchAndDisplayRadarData(10);}, 10000);
// setTimeout(() => {fetchAndDisplayRadarData(11);}, 11000);
// setTimeout(() => {fetchAndDisplayRadarData(12);}, 12000);
// }
// animateSteps();
// radarInterval = setInterval(animateSteps, 15000)
// } else {
// clearInterval(radarInterval)
// }
// }
const radarLayer = L.layerGroup().addTo(map);
async function fetchAndDisplayRadarData(time) {
radarLayer.clearLayers();
if (!time) {
time = 12;
}
const data = await fetch(`https://api.rainviewer.com/public/weather-maps.json?timestamp=${new Date}`).then(response => response.json()); // use new date to prevent caching
const latestPath = data.radar.past[time].path;
const tileUrl = data.host + latestPath + `/256/{z}/{x}/{y}/4/1_1.png`;
const radar = L.tileLayer(tileUrl, {
attribution: 'RainViewer',
opacity: 0.6
});
radarLayer.addLayer(radar);
}
fetchAndDisplayRadarData(11);
// playButton.onclick = animateRadar(!animatingRadar);
// L.tileLayer.wms("https://opengeo.ncep.noaa.gov/geoserver/conus/conus_cref_qcd/ows?", {
// layers: 'conus_cref_qcd',
// format: 'image/png',
// transparent: true,
// timestamp: new Date()
// }).addTo(map);
var iconSize = [15, 15]
var locationIcon = L.icon({
iconUrl: './assets/locationMarker.png',
iconSize: iconSize,
iconAnchor: iconSize / 2
});
const markerLayerGroup = L.layerGroup().addTo(map);
var marker = L.marker(coords, { icon: locationIcon });
function makeLocationMarker() {
if (showLocation == true) {
markerLayerGroup.addLayer(marker);
map.invalidateSize();
} else {
markerLayerGroup.clearLayers();
map.invalidateSize();
}
}
makeLocationMarker();
function toggleLocationMarker() {
showLocation = !showLocation;
makeLocationMarker();
}
locationButton.addEventListener('click', function() { // use addEventListener because onclick is used by another script
toggleLocationMarker();
})
map.attributionControl.setPrefix(false);
var watermark;
var mapOpen = false;
function mapSize() {
if (!mapOpen) {
mapOpen = true;
closeAlert();
mapDiv.style.width = '100%';
mapDiv.style.height = '100%';
mapContainer.style.width = '100%';
mapContainer.style.height = '100%';
mapReturn.style.display = 'block';
map.invalidateSize(); // refresh map size
watermark = L.control.watermark({ position: 'bottomleft' }).addTo(map);
} else {
mapOpen = false;
closeAlert();
mapDiv.style.width = '250px';
mapDiv.style.height = '150px';
mapContainer.style.width = '250px';
mapContainer.style.height = '150px';
mapReturn.style.display = 'none';
map.invalidateSize(); // refresh map size
map.removeControl(watermark);
}
}
mapReturn.onclick = mapSize;
radarButton.onclick = mapSize;
L.Control.Watermark = L.Control.extend({
onAdd: function() {
var img = L.DomUtil.create('img');
img.src = './assets/logo.png';
img.style.width = '400px';
img.style.paddingBottom = '10px';
img.style.paddingLeft = '10px';
img.style.filter = 'drop-shadow(0 0 3px black)';
return img;
},
});
L.control.watermark = function(opts) {
return new L.Control.Watermark(opts);
}
// alert handling
const alertsLayerGroup = L.layerGroup().addTo(map);
const api = 'https://api.weather.gov/alerts/active';
function fetchAlerts() {
fetch(api).then(res => res.json()).then(data => {
const filteredData = data.features.filter(alert =>
(alert.properties.event.includes("Winter")
|| alert.properties.event == "Special Weather Statement"
|| alert.properties.event.includes("Tornado")
|| alert.properties.event.includes("Severe Thunderstorm")
|| alert.properties.event.includes("Flood")
|| alert.properties.event.includes('Extreme Wind')
|| alert.properties.event.includes('Avalanche')
|| alert.properties.event.includes('Snow Squall')
|| alert.properties.event.includes('Tsunami Warning')
|| alert.properties.event.includes('Blizzard')) && (
alert.properties.event != 'Avalanche Advisory'
)
);
loadPolygons(filteredData);
})
}
fetchAlerts();
setInterval(fetchAlerts, 30000);
var alertDescActive = false;
function showAlertDescription() {
if (alertDescActive) {
alertDescActive = false;
descriptionDisplay.style.display = 'none';
dropdownIcon.innerHTML = 'keyboard_arrow_down';
} else {
alertDescActive = true;
descriptionDisplay.style.display = 'block';
dropdownIcon.innerHTML = 'keyboard_arrow_up';
}
}
alertDropdown.onclick = showAlertDescription;
function closeAlert() {
alertEventBG.style.display = 'none';
closeWarningButton.style.display = 'none';
}
closeWarningButton.onclick = closeAlert;
function loadPolygons(data) {
alertsLayerGroup.clearLayers();
data.forEach(alert => {
if (alert.geometry == null) {
var zones = alert.properties.affectedZones;
for (var i = 0; i < zones.length; i++) {
fetch(zones[i]).then(res => res.json()).then(data => {
mapAlert(alert, data.geometry)
})
}
} else {
mapAlert(alert, alert.geometry)
}
});
// tornado warnings = red solid
// tor confirmed = red dash
// pds tor = pink solid
// tor e = pink dash
function mapAlert(alert, geometry) {
var dashes = 0;
var color = 'blue';
var fillOpacity = 0;
var fillColor = 'transparent';
if (alert.properties.event == 'Tornado Warning') {
if (alert.properties.parameters.tornadoDamageThreat && alert.properties.parameters.tornadoDamageThreat == 'CATASTROPHIC') {
color = 'magenta';
dashes = 10;
} else if (alert.properties.parameters.tornadoDamageThreat && alert.properties.parameters.tornadoDamageThreat == 'CONSIDERABLE') {
color = 'magenta';
} else if (alert.properties.parameters.tornadoDetection == 'OBSERVED') {
color = 'red';
dashes = 10;
} else {
color = 'red';
}
} else if (alert.properties.event == 'Severe Thunderstorm Warning') {
color = 'rgb(255, 196, 0)';
if (alert.properties.parameters.thunderstormDamageThreat && alert.properties.parameters.thunderstormDamageThreat == 'DESTRUCTIVE') {
dashes = 10;
fillOpacity = 0.5;
fillColor = 'magenta';
} else if (alert.properties.parameters.thunderstormDamageThreat && alert.properties.parameters.thunderstormDamageThreat == 'CONSIDERABLE') {
dashes = 10;
}
} else if (alert.properties.event == 'Flash Flood Warning') {
color = 'rgb(0, 255, 0)'
if (alert.properties.parameters.flashFloodDamageThreat && alert.properties.parameters.flashFloodDamageThreat == 'CATASTROPHIC') {
dashes = 10;
}
} else if (alert.properties.event == 'Flood Warning') {
color = 'green';
} else if (alert.properties.event == 'Winter Weather Advisory') {
color = 'rgb(32,77,158)';
} else if (alert.properties.event == 'Winter Storm Warning') {
color = 'rgb(254,106,179)';
} else if (alert.properties.event == 'Winter Storm Watch') {
color = 'rgb(32,77,158)';
} else if (alert.properties.event == 'Severe Thunderstorm Watch') {
color = 'rgb(255,255,0)';
} else if (alert.properties.event == 'Tornado Watch') {
color = 'salmon';
} else if (alert.properties.event == 'Special Weather Statement') {
color = 'rgb(135,206,235)';
} else if (alert.properties.event == 'High Wind Warning') {
color = '#daa520';
} else if (alert.properties.event == 'High Wind Watch' || alert.properties.event == 'Wind Advisory') {
color = '#d2b48c';
} else if (alert.properties.event == 'Avalanche Warning') {
color = '#1e90ff';
} else if (alert.properties.event == 'Avalanche Watch') {
color = '#f4a460';
} else if (alert.properties.event == 'Snow Squall Warning') {
color = '#c71585';
} else if (alert.properties.event == 'Blizzard Warning') {
color = '#ff4500';
} else if (alert.properties.event == 'Tsunami Warning') {
color = '#fd6347';
}
const alertOutline = L.geoJSON(geometry, {
style: {
color: 'black',
weight: 3.5,
opacity: 1,
fillColor: fillColor,
fillOpacity: fillOpacity
}
});
const alertLayer = L.geoJSON(geometry, {
style: {
color: color,
weight: 1.5,
opacity: 1,
dashArray: dashes,
fillColor: 'transparent',
fillOpacity: 0
}
});
const options = {
month: 'short',
day: '2-digit',
year: 'numeric',
hour: '2-digit',
minute: '2-digit',
hour12: true
};
alertLayer.on('click', function() {
alertEvent.innerHTML = alert.properties.event;
alertEvent.style.backgroundColor = color;
alertDetails.innerText = `${alert.properties.areaDesc}\nExpires: ${Intl.DateTimeFormat('en-US', options).format(new Date(alert.properties.expires))}\n`;
alertDetails.style.display = 'block';
alertDropdown.style.display = 'block';
closeWarningButton.style.display = 'block';
alertEventBG.style.display = 'block';
descriptionDisplay.innerHTML = alert.properties.description.replace(/\n/g, '<br/>');
if (alert.properties.event == "Severe Thunderstorm Warning") {
if (alert.properties.parameters.thunderstormDamageThreat == "DESTRUCTIVE") {
alertDetails.innerHTML += "<i style='background-color: purple; padding-left: 5px; padding-right: 10px; border-radius: 5px;'>THIS IS A DESTRUCTIVE STORM</i><br/>";
} else if (alert.properties.parameters.thunderstormDamageThreat == "CONSIDERABLE") {
alertDetails.innerHTML += "<i style='background-color: white; color: black; padding-left: 5px; padding-right: 10px; border-radius: 5px;'>THIS IS A CONSIDERABLE STORM</i><br/>";
}
var hail;
if (alert.properties.parameters.maxHailSize) {
hail = alert.properties.parameters.maxHailSize;
} else {
hail = '0.00';
}
alertDetails.innerHTML += `Hail: ${hail} in<br/>`;
alertDetails.innerHTML += `Wind: ${alert.properties.parameters.maxWindGust}<br/>`;
if (alert.properties.parameters.tornadoDetection) {
alertDetails.innerHTML += `Tornado: <span style="color: red;">${alert.properties.parameters.tornadoDetection}</span>`;
}
} else if (alert.properties.event == "Tornado Warning") {
if (alert.properties.parameters.tornadoDetection == "OBSERVED") {
alertDetails.innerHTML += `Tornado: <span style="background-color: white; color: red; padding-left: 5px; padding-right: 5px; border-radius: 5px;">${alert.properties.parameters.tornadoDetection}</span><br/>`;
} else {
alertDetails.innerHTML += `Tornado: ${alert.properties.parameters.tornadoDetection}<br/>`;
}
alertDetails.innerHTML += `Hail: ${alert.properties.parameters.maxHailSize} in`;
} else if (alert.properties.event == "Flash Flood Warning") {
if (alert.properties.parameters.flashFloodDamageThreat == "CATASTROPHIC") {
alertEvent.innerHTML = 'FLASH FLOOD EMERGENCY';
alertDetails.innerHTML += "Flash Flood Damage Threat: <span style='background-color: magenta; text-shadow: 2px 2px 4px black; padding-left: 5px; padding-right: 5px; border-radius: 5px;'>CATASTROPHIC</span><br/>";
} else if (alert.properties.parameters.flashFloodDamageThreat == "CONSIDERABLE") {
alertDetails.innerHTML += "Flash Flood Damage Threat: <span style='background-color: white; color: black; padding-left: 5px; padding-right: 5px; border-radius: 5px;'>CONSIDERABLE</span><br/>";
}
alertDetails.innerHTML += `SOURCE: ${alert.properties.parameters.flashFloodDetection}`;
}
});
alertsLayerGroup.addLayer(alertOutline);
alertsLayerGroup.addLayer(alertLayer);
if (alert.geometry == null) {
alertLayer.bringToBack();
alertOutline.bringToBack();
}
}
}
}
loadMap();
setInterval(loadMap, 60000);
})
